Division of Student Affairs and Enrollment Management
The Student Affairs and Enrollment Management team serves many roles consistent with the mission
of Bluefield State College. Their beliefs about higher education serve as the foundation for their commitment
to the development of "the whole person."
The
staff establishes early contact in the community and public schools to
promote the value of, as well as the opportunity for, higher education.
Through appropriate intervention strategies, students are provided
services to foster individual success.
Students
are provided the opportunity to develop and achieve their individual
goals with the coordinated support, cooperation and encouragement of
faculty and staff. High expectations will be set and communicated while
engaging students in active learning. Students are enriched and
encouraged socially, intellectually, culturally, economically and
personally through classroom as well as extracurricular activities.
The
staff cultivates lifelong learning by engaging in ongoing developmental
and professional training. Through networking techniques and sharing of
resources, the staff continues to grow while seeking to improve student
and institutional performance.
